Reps approve Tinubu’s $516.33m loan for Sokoto-Badagry superhighway project

The House of Representatives on Tuesday approved President Bola Tinubu’s request to secure a $516.33m loan from Deutsche Bank to finance Section I of the ambitious Sokoto-Badagry Superhighway project, a key infrastructure initiative under the administration’s Renewed Hope Agenda. The approval followed the consideration of the President’s request by the Committee of Supply during plenary […]

Reps to approve debt relief for Kano, Jos, Ikeja DisCos

The House of Representatives Public Accounts Committee has resolved to approve financial relief measures and a 10-year debt restructuring framework for the Kano, Jos, and Ikeja Electricity Distribution Companies. The decision covers N128.6bn in accrued interest on debts from 2015 to September 2025 to be waived, and historical debts amounting to N120.1b to be restructured […]

Reps endorse green climate finance bank

The House of Representatives has endorsed the proposed establishment of a Green and Climate Finance Bank for Nigeria. The lawmakers described the initiative as a strategic move to deepen financing for renewable energy and climate-aligned investments. The Chairman of the House Committee on Renewable Energy, Afam Ogene, stated this position during a joint media briefing […]

Reps probe non-release of ₦174.26bn agric intervention funds

The House of Representatives has commenced an investigation into the alleged non-release of N174.26 billion in agricultural intervention funds. The probe directs Ministries, Departments and Agencies as well as development partners to fully cooperate with the fact-finding exercise. The Chairman of the House Committee on Agricultural Production and Services, Bello Ka’oje, made this known in […]

Reps pass Tinubu’s ₦58.18trn 2026 appropriation bill

The House of Representatives, on Thursday, approved President Bola Tinubu’s 2026 Appropriation Bill, endorsing a proposed N58.18 trillion budget anchored on macro-economic stability, enhanced security, and increased capital expenditure. The budget, christened “The Budget of Consolidation, Renewed Resilience and Shared Prosperity,” was presented to the National Assembly on December 19, 2025, and described by lawmakers […]
